Rey Maualuga is practicing Thursday. Good chance he plays week 11.
Maualuga missed last week's game against the Giants but looks to get back into action against the Bills this week. He's gotten multiple tackles in six of eight games played this year.
Bengals linebacker Rey Maualuga is not expected to play in Week 10 against the Giants.
Although he has not missed a game this season, he has missed two practices and could be absent from the lineup for more than just Week 10. He has an unspecified injury to his fibula. Fortunately for the Bengals, they have veteran linebacker Vincent Rey to step in and take over for Maualuga, so their linebacking crew is still in good shape, if perhaps lacking a bit of depth.
Rey Maualuga (fibula) did not participate in practice Friday.
Due to a fibula injury, Cincinnati Bengals MLB Rey Maualuga missed practice both on Thursday and Friday. He is listed as questionable for the Monday night tilt against the New York Giants. The specifics of his injury are relatively unknown, but if he is actually ruled out, he will likely be replaced Vincent Rey.
Maualuga is not expected to play Monday night.
Maualuga is dealing with a leg injury. He will have to sit out the prime-time match up with the Giants. Vincent Rey will start in his place at MLB.
